
Kai Sun's Resume
求职意向
2022 届硕士,期望后端开发相关岗位。熟悉 Python、C/C# 等编程语言,可根据岗位要求转语言,具有良好的编程习惯和文档编写能力;熟悉数据结构与算法、计算机网络和操作系统相关的基础知识;会基本的 Linux 操作,有 VPS 使用和个人网站部署经历;有很强的自主学习和解决问题能力,能够高效地进行团队沟通和协作。
教育背景
上海科技大学
2019 年 8 月 ~ 2022 年 6 月
- 信息科学与技术学院
- 电子科学与技术
西安理工大学
2015 年 8 月 ~ 2019 年 6 月
- 自动化与信息工程学院
- 自动化
项目经历
中广核涡流检测数据仿真软件
2019 年 9 月 ~ 2021 年 7 月
项目描述
使用涡流原理和 FEM 对蒸汽发生管道和探头进行数值仿真,得到不同缺陷的图像和检出概率曲线。
项目职责
- 编写被检对象和探头的 Mesh 程序和 FEM 计算程序,测试正确性并优化;
- 编写探头阻抗特性数值计算程序,并使用 PyQt5 制作阻抗特性计算界面;
- 使用 Berens 模型计算 POD,并将结果传输到前端界面;
- 基于 WinForm 框架制作界面,并编写相关的控件、布局、事件以及接口等程序;
- 编写软件文档、接口协议、测试方案和测试样例,调试程序并修复漏洞;
- 搭建并维护软件仓库,部署程序并最终成功发布。
金泽水面漂浮物智能检测系统
2020 年 12 月 ~ 2021 年 5 月
项目描述
训练部署 YOLOv5 模型,对金泽水库取水口和水文站水面漂浮物(船、水葫芦)进行实时检测和推送。
项目职责
- 使用 OpenCV 截取 IP 摄像头的 RTSP 视频流,并解决因为带宽引起的丢帧问题;
- 训练部署 YOLOv5 模型,平均准确度在 0.98 以上,并将其封装为 Detect 类;
- 将 YOLOv5 模型结果输入到 DeepSort 追踪器中,实现实时目标跟踪和计数;
- 使用 Redis 做图片缓存,实时存储模型输出结果,并部署 Flask 服务器进行推送;
- 保存漂浮物信息到 Oracle 数据库、部署 Nginx 图片服务器以供前端查询检测结果;
- 采用多进程方式,将任务分为多个独立进程,进程间通过 Pipe 通信。
科研成果
论文
- Experiment Assisted Model-based POD: A Comparative Study of TMR and Coil Array Probes, under review at Journal of Nondestructive Evaluation
- Numerical Calculation of Frequency Characteristic of Induction Coils, accepted by 2021 IEEE Far East Forum on Nondestructive Evaluation/Testing
发明专利
- 一种核电站涡流检测探头的制作方法
软件著作
- 涡流检测数据仿真软件
- 涡流检测探头阻抗特性计算软件
奖励荣誉
国家级
- 2018 年美国大学生交又学科建模竞赛二等奖
- 2017 年全国大学生数学建模竟赛全国二等奖
- 2017 年全国大学生电子设计竞赛全国二等奖(控制组陕西省第一名)
- 2017 年全国大学生智能汽车竞赛全国二等奖
- 2017 年度国家励志奖学金
- 2016 年度国家励志奖学金
省市级
- 2017 年全国大学生电子设计竞赛陕西赛区省级一等奖
- 2017 年全国大学生智能汽车竞赛西部赛区省级一等奖
- 2018 年吴江创新奖学金
校院级
- 2020 年度学业奖学金(¥8000)
- 2019 年度学业奖学金(¥8000)
- 2018 年创新成果一等奖
- 2018 年西安理工大学第一届大学生电子设计与技能竞赛一等奖
- 2017 年西安理工大学第二十六届大学生课外学术科技竞赛特等奖
- 2017 年西安理工大学第二十六届“理奥杯”大学生课外学术科技作品竞赛特等奖
- 2017 年西安理工大学“互联网+”大学生创新创业大赛一等奖
- 2017 年度尚真笃学先进个人
- 2016 年西安理工大学第二十五届大学生课外学术科技竞赛一等奖
- 2016 年度三好学生标兵
- 2016 年度优秀团员
技能清单
- 编程:Python, MATLAB, C/C#, Markdown, LaTeX
- Python:熟悉 Python 基础、常用容器、面向对象编程、装饰器、GIL、垃圾回收机制和并发编程
- 工具:熟练使用 Git、SSH、VMware、Anaconda 和 Typora
- 数据结构:熟悉数组、链表、栈、队列、堆、散列表和布隆过滤器等常用的数据结构
- 算法:了解排序、查找、搜索、贪心、分治和回溯等常用的算法思想
- 操作系统:熟悉进程、线程和协程,了解进程间通信、死锁和内存管理
- 网络:熟悉 TCP/IP 五层模型,了解 HTTP(S)、DNS、TCP、UPD 和 IP 等常用的网络协议
- 开发环境:熟练使用 PyCharm、Visual Studio 和 Visual Studio Code
- 语言:英语四级:598,英语六级:443
校园经历
- 2017 年 6 月 ~ 2018 年 4 月:西安理工大学大学生科技协会副主席
- 2017 年 6 月 ~ 2018 年 6 月:西安理工大学自动化科学与技术协会技术团骨干
- 2017 年 5 月 ~ 2018 年 4 月:西安理工大学工程训练中心创客工坊社长